C++ map min element time complexity
WebApr 6, 2024 · To create a vector in C++, you need to include the header file and declare a vector object. Here's an example: #include std::vectormy_vector You can add elements to the vector using the push_back() method: my_vector.push_back(1); my_vector.push_back(2); You can access elements in the … WebNov 17, 2024 · Note: As we observe, time complexity is O(n), but we are solving the problem using less number of comparisons (In the worst case). Efficient approach: Incrementing loop by 2 Algorithm idea
C++ map min element time complexity
Did you know?
WebMar 13, 2024 · C++ STL provides a similar function sort that sorts a vector or array (items with random access). The time complexity of this function is O(nlogn). Example: Input ... (first_index, last_index): To find the maximum element of a array/vector. *min_element (first_index, last_index): To find the minimum element of ... Map of Vectors in C++ STL … WebJul 31, 2024 · The time complexity of the getMedian operation is O(1). While adding a new integer, we must determine its correct position in the list such that the list remains sorted. ... (max. element of smaller half + min. element of larger half) / 2 else if smaller half contains more elements: median = max. element of smaller half else if larger half ...
WebThe comparisons are performed using either operator< for the first version, or comp for the second; An element is the smallest if no other element compares less than it. If more … WebYou would simply get the front of the value-key map. Lastly, you can always just keep track of the minimum element going into your map. Every time you insert a new value, check if it's lower than your current value (and that should be probably be a pointer to a map pair, start it as null), and if it's lower, point to the new lowest.
WebApr 8, 2024 · How to convert binary string to int in C++? In programming, converting a binary string to an integer is a very common task. Binary is a base-2 number system, which means that it has only two digits, 0 and 1.In C++, you can easily convert a binary string to an integer using the built-in "stoi" function. This function takes a string as input and converts it to an … WebFeb 26, 2024 · what is time complexity of min_element () Phoenix Logan. So, according to the link here: the max_element function is O (n),\ beacuase it touches at least every …
Web13 hours ago · Time and Space Complexity. The time complexity of the above code is O(Q*N*log(D)), where Q is the number of queries, N is the number of elements in the array, and D is the highest number present in the array. The space complexity of the above code is O(1), as we are not using any extra space.
WebMay 10, 2024 · If found, we find the distance between current index and previous index of the same element stored in the map. We are using an unordered_map so space … comic black girlWebJun 3,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. comic black spidermanWebA priority queue is a container adaptor that provides constant time lookup of the largest (by default) element, at the expense of logarithmic insertion and extraction. A user-provided Compare can be supplied to change the ordering, e.g. using std::greater would cause the smallest element to appear as the top () . comic black knightWebBack to: Data Structures and Algorithms Tutorials Finding Maximum Element in a Linked List using C Language: In this article, I am going to discuss How to Find the Maximum Element in a Linked List using C Language with Examples.Please read our previous article, where we discussed the Sum of all elements in a Linked List using C Language with … comic black holeWebOct 5, 2024 · In Big O, there are six major types of complexities (time and space): Constant: O (1) Linear time: O (n) Logarithmic time: O (n log n) Quadratic time: O (n^2) Exponential time: O (2^n) Factorial time: O (n!) … dr. worthington fairbanks akWebFeb 12, 2014 · This depends on the implementation, you can't associate a complexity of any kind to std::map just by looking at the language specs. Usually an std::map is … comic black setcomicblessing